Abstract
At a location between a single facer machine and a glue machine, a web of corrugated paperboard has the flutes crushed in a narrow zone longitudinally of the web. A bonding agent is applied only to the uncrushed flutes. Preprinted liners are applied to the bonding agent on the uncrushed flutes with the liners being spaced from one another by said narrow zone.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edI claim:
1. In a corrugator wherein a bridge is located between a single facer machine and a glue machine and adapted to feed a web of single face paperboard to the glue machine, means located between the single facer machine and the glue machine for longitudinally crushing a narrow portion of the flutes on the flute side of the web, and means associated with the glue machine for applying at least two liners to the uncrushed flutes on the web so that only crushed flutes are uncovered between adjacent longitudinal sides of the liners and said liners being side-by-side and transversely spaced by said narrow portion of crushed flutes.
2. In a corrugator in accordance with claim 1 wherein said flute crushing means includes mating rollers, one of said rollers being adjustably mounted on a shaft in a manner which facilitates adjustment of the roller to a desired location along the shaft.
3. In a corrugator in accordance with claim 1 wherein said last mentioned means includes at least one support stand for supporting at least two rolls of liner material transversely offset with respect to said glue machine.
4. In a corrugator in accordance with claim 1 wherein said crushing means includes a pair of mating rollers defining a gap therebetween through which the web must pass, and means for adjusting one of said rollers relative to the other to vary the size of the gap.
5. In a corrugator wherein a bridge is located between a single facer machine and a glue machine and adapted to feed a web of single faced paperboard to the glue machine, means located between the single facer machine and the glue machine for longitudinally crushing a narrow portion of the flutes on the flute side of the web, said crushing means including a pair of mating rollers defining a gap therebetween through which the web must pass, means for adjusting one of said rollers relative to the other to adjust the size of the gap, one of said rollers being adjustably mounted on a shaft in a manner which facilitates adjustment to a desired location along the shaft, and applying means associated with the glue machine for applying at least two liners to the uncrushed flutes on the web so that only crushed flutes are uncovered between adjacent longitudinal side edges of the liners and said liners being side-by-side and transversely spaced by said narrow portion of crushed flutes, said applying means including first and second liner support stands for supporting a roll of liner material, said support stands being transversely staggered with respect to said glue machine.
